Conolidine is definitely an indole alkaloid derived from your bark with the tropical flowering shrub Tabernaemontana divaricate

Most not too long ago, it's been recognized that conolidine and the above mentioned derivatives act over the atypical chemokine receptor three (ACKR3. Expressed in identical locations as classical opioid receptors, it binds to your wide array of endogenous opioids. Compared with most opioid receptors, this receptor functions for a scavenger and isn't going to activate a 2nd messenger process (fifty nine). As talked over by Meyrath et al., this also indicated a possible url involving these receptors plus the endogenous opiate process (fifty nine). This research finally established the ACKR3 receptor did not deliver any G protein sign reaction by measuring and finding no mini G protein interactions, contrary to classical opiate receptors, which recruit these proteins for signaling.

This receptor also binds to opioid peptides, but as an alternative to resulting in pain reduction, it traps the peptides and prevents them from binding to any of the common receptors, Hence probably stopping soreness modulation.

In 2011, the Bohn lab famous antinociception towards equally chemically induced and inflammation-derived ache, and experiments indicated lack of opioid receptor modulation, but were being unable to outline a particular focus on.
